java中如何让代码查询文件数据
时间: 2024-02-21 14:00:07 浏览: 8
在Java中,可以使用File类和Scanner类来查询文件数据。以下是一个简单的例子:
```java
import java.io.File;
import java.io.FileNotFoundException;
import java.util.Scanner;
public class FileSearch {
public static void main(String[] args) {
try {
// 创建一个File对象来表示要查询的文件
File file = new File("file.txt");
// 创建一个Scanner对象来读取文件数据
Scanner scanner = new Scanner(file);
// 读取文件中的每一行数据
while (scanner.hasNextLine()) {
String line = scanner.nextLine();
// 在这里可以对每一行数据进行处理
System.out.println(line);
}
// 关闭Scanner对象
scanner.close();
} catch (FileNotFoundException e) {
e.printStackTrace();
}
}
}
```
在这个例子中,我们使用File类来创建一个表示要查询的文件的对象,然后使用Scanner类来读取文件数据。在while循环中,我们可以对每一行数据进行处理,例如输出到控制台。最后,我们要记得关闭Scanner对象。